The Nature of Middle-earth: Late Writings on the Lands, Inhabitants, and Metaphysics of Middle-earth is a book of previously unpublished texts by J.R.R. Tolkien, compiled by Carl F. Hostetter, who had been sent the texts for publication by Christopher Tolkien in 2020.[1] Addressing numerous topics on inner workings and close details of Tolkien's world of Arda, the book was published by HarperCollins and Mariner Books in September 2021.

It is the first publication to exclusively feature essays by J.R.R. Tolkien that all solely concern his Middle-earth legendarium.

A solicitation released by HarperCollins describes the book as the unofficial fourteenth volume of The History of Middle-earth, though it is to be noted the publication is fully approved by the Tolkien Estate.[2] The full description is as follows:

The first ever publication of J. R. R. Tolkien’s final writings on Middle-earth, covering a wide-range of subjects, and the perfect next read for those who have enjoyed Unfinished Tales and the History of Middle-earth series and are hungry for more.

The Nature of Middle-earth will comprise numerous late (c. 1959-73) and previously unpublished writings by J.R.R. Tolkien on the “nature” of Middle-earth, in both chief senses of that word: both metaphysical and natural/historical.

For Tolkien fans, readers, and scholars interested in learning more about Tolkien’s own views on Middle-earth. It will appeal in particular to those readers who enjoyed Unfinished Tales, and some of the later volumes of the History of Middle-earth. Indeed, many of the texts to be included are closely associated with materials published in those places, and were sent to Hostetter, specifically, in photocopy by Christopher Tolkien for potential publication.

Contents[]

  • Part One: Time and Ageing (of 23 chapters)
  • Part Two: Body, Mind, and Spirit (of 17 chapters)
  • Part Three: The World, its Lands, and its Inhabitants (of 22 chapters)
  • Appendix on Metaphysical and Theological Themes
  • Glossary and Index of Quenya Terms
  • General index

Among the topics covered in The Nature of Middle-earth are fate and free will, the Valar's telepathy and the Ósanwe-kenta, Dwarven beards, how different races of Middle-earth age, the making of lembas bread, how Eru Ilúvatar was the source of all creativity, the lands and animals of Númenor, and many others. Much of the topics and details covered fittingly address the varying curiosities that Middle-earth fans acquired through the decades from reading The Hobbit and especially The Lord of the Rings, which Tolkien commented on in a 1956 letter to H. Cotton Minchin, expressing how different readers who wrote to him desired further information on Middle-earth's cultures, botany, music, the workings of Elvish languages, and other matters.
